After testing these bands for weeks, I'm convinced they're the best budget-friendly alternative to Apple's pricier straps. The soft silicone feels surprisingly premium against the skin—no irritation even during sweaty workouts.
The variety of colors (especially those matching Series 7/8 official hues) lets me coordinate with outfits effortlessly. My favorites? The muted abyss blue for professional settings and vibrant marigold for weekend adventures.
Installation is foolproof—the redesigned buckle clicks securely without tools. Unlike some third-party bands I've tried, these never accidentally detach during HIIT sessions... though I'd avoid ocean swimming after one reviewer's saltwater mishap!
Durability impresses me most. After months of gym use, showering with them daily (yes, they're truly waterproof), and constant color-swapping, the material shows zero cracks or fading. They're slightly thinner than OEM bands but maintain shape remarkably well.
The value is unbeatable: six bands cost less than one original Apple Sport Band. While they lack the seamless lugs of Apple's design, the fit is precise—my 45mm Series 8 sits snugly without gaps.
Pro tip: The 'starlight' color hides sweat marks better than darker shades. For those wanting OEM-level quality without the price tag, these deliver 90% of the experience at 20% of the cost.
